Output 951ffb46ed0579dee04f9fa7d59801b719c4d0c025a577985efa5bcce439f021:24

value
23036469
script pubkey
OP_0 OP_PUSHBYTES_20 d4e24561e2d3c8a694f77c6549563e598cd68ea3
address
bc1q6n3y2c0z60y2d98h03j5j437txxddr4rcaezef
transaction
951ffb46ed0579dee04f9fa7d59801b719c4d0c025a577985efa5bcce439f021
spent
true